Have you voted early yet?
Take advantage of shorter lines and more polling places by voting this week. Early voting ends Friday evening, and the primary election day is Tuesday. Remember that most races in Texas are decided by the outcomes of the primaries and not the general election in November. Now is the time to make sure educators' voices are heard!
